Computer Systems Networking is offered at a wide range of schools, including schools where students can earn the degree primarily online. This ranking identifies the online schools that graduate the most computer systems networking students each year.
For its ranking, College Factual looked at how many students completed a degree in computer systems networking at each of the 79 schools in the United States that offer the program.
Mycomputercareeredu Raleigh tops our list of the most popular computer systems networking schools. Mycomputercareeredu Raleigh is a private for-profit school located in the city of Raleigh. This school awarded about 1,606 computer systems networking degrees in the most recent year.

This ranking is produced by College Factual. Schools are ranked by the number of students who complete a degree in the program each year (completions), drawn from the U.S. Department of Education (IPEDS). This online edition is limited to schools that deliver the program primarily through online or distance education.
The Integrated Postsecondary Education Data System (IPEDS) from the National Center for Education Statistics (NCES), a branch of the U.S. Department of Education (DOE), serves as the core of our data about colleges.
